- The distance between Raga, Sudan and Covington, La, Usa is approximately 11,893 km or 7,390 mi.
- To reach Raga in this distance one would set out from Covington, La bearing 68.7°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Raga bearing 126.1° or SE .
- Raga has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Covington, La has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Raga is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Covington, La is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 6.2 °C (11.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10 °C (18°F) less in Raga.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 450.7 mm (17.7 in) less which is equivalent to 450.7 l/m² (11.06 US gal/ft²) or 4,507,000 l/ha (481,828 US gal/ac) less. About 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.9° higher in Raga than in Covington, La.
